Hi, the MAC address filtering settings can be accessed by logging into your router's configuration software (type 192.168.1.1 into your web browser and hit Enter, then type in your username and password) and going to the Wireless tab and beneath that, Wireless MAC Filter. You can either choose Disable to turn the MAC filter off completely, or you can choose Edit MAC Filter List and add your Kindle's MAC address to the list of approved devices.

First of all there are two types of kindle, the kindle 3g + WIFI and the Kindle WIFI. If you bought the kindle WIFI you will be unable to connect to a 3g network. If you bought a 3g model you can access 3g internet by pressing the 'menu' button and then using the 5-way to navigate to 'turn on wireless'. Once wireless is on you can access your browser by clicking menu, scrolling to experimental and then selecting Web Browser
